THERMAL STABILITY AND KINETIC STUDIES OF COBALT (II), NICKEL (II), COPPER (II), CADMIUM (II) AND MERCURY (II) COMPLEXES DERIVED FROM N-SALICYLIDENE SCHIFF BASES

The thermal properties of a number of Schiff base metal complexes in nitrogen atmosphere have been investigated by thermogravimetry (TG) and differential thermogravimetry (DTG). The kinetic analyses of the thermal decomposition were studied using the Coats-Redfern and Horowitz-Metzger equations. The obtained kinetic parameters show the kinetic compensation effect.
